Schaeffler Needle Roller Bearing, 15mm Inside Diameter, 23mm Outside Diameter - NK15/20-XL


This needle roller bearing is designed for robust performance in various applications. With an inside diameter of 15mm and an outside diameter of 23mm, it features a race width of 20mm. This product excels in providing precision and reliability, making it ideal for mechanical and automation tasks.

Features & Benefits


• High dynamic load rating of 15,400N enhances reliability

• Static load rating of 17,200N supports exceptional performance

• Excellent fatigue limit load of 3,050N for durability

• Suitable for parallel bore type ensuring ease of installation

What factors should I consider regarding operational temperature limits?


The operational temperature range for this product spans from -30°C to 120°C, allowing it to operate effectively in various environments. Ensure the application does not exceed these limits for optimal performance.

What maintenance practices are recommended for durability?


Regular inspection and lubrication are advised to maintain functionality and extend the life of the bearing, particularly in high-speed or heavy-duty applications.

How does this bearing address space constraints in design?


The needle design allows for a compact and lightweight solution, making it suitable for mechanical assemblies where space is a critical factor.

What makes this bearing suitable for high-speed applications?


With a limiting speed of 23,900r/min, this bearing is engineered to support high-speed operations, making it a preferred choice for performance-driven tasks.
